BOCA RATON, Fla. - The Lynn University women's lacrosse team delivered an offensive showcase on Wednesday afternoon, defeating Alabama Huntsville, 20-8, to improve to 5-2 on the season.

FIGHTING KNIGHT STATS:
- Huggins led the offense with four goals and three assists for seven points
- Clagett recorded six points on two goals and four assists
- She also collected three ground balls, caused three turnovers and won a season-high eight draw controls
- Stewart, Exley, and Lunardi scored two goals each for the Fighting Knights
- Smith finished with three points on a goal and two assists, while Fox contributed a goal and two assists
- Lynn had 13 different goal scorers and 13 total assists in the balanced offensive effort
- The Blue and White held advantages in shots (32-15), ground balls (13-11), and draw controls (20-9)
